2015-03-11 Thread Debajit Adhikary
I am trying to use a piped CustomLog to filter my logs: httpd.conf:CustomLog |/bin/sed -r s/pass/REDACTED/g /workplace/tmp/access.log common However, when I make a request to Apache, I get an error saying/bin/sed: can't read : No such file or directory How can I get this working? (It seems

On Thu, Mar 12, 2015 at 12:03 AM, Yann Ylavic ylavic@gmail.com wrote: With Apache 2.4.x, you probably have to use : CustomLog $|/bin/sed -r s/pass/REDACTED/g /workplace/tmp/access.log common Oups, I meant |$..., with the $ *after* the |.
